      The incubation period for pink eye is 24 to 72 hours and the infection is communicable throughout the course of the active infection. Depending on the type of pink eye infection (bacterial or viral), the infection can last anywhere from 3 to 5 days for bacterial, and 7 to 14 days in complicated viral cases.

      TRANSMISSION: Conjunctivitis is transmitted by contact with the discharge from the infected eye or the respiratory tract of infected persons. It may also be spread by contaminated fingers, clothing or articles (eye makeup). It can be transmitted in the acute stage during the active infection. The incubation period is approximately 24 to 27 hours.

      PINK-EYE (conjunctivitis) Incubation, Signs and Symptoms Incubation Period: Viral: varies from 12 hours to 12 days.Bacterial: 24-72 hours. Signs and Symptoms: Redness of eye(s), watery, white or yellow discharge from the eye, matted eyelashes, burning or itching eyes.
